`Founder & CEO
`
`3DVU (formally FlyOver)
`January 2000 — 2010 (10 years)
`
`Patented technology for 3D Visualization of aerial and satellite imagery for mobile navigation.
`Navigate over the entire country with 3D photography and landscape elevation on your Windows
`Mobile, Symbian or BlackBerry.
`
`Product Launch: First Commercial Release was in-car navigation system by Kenwood in Japan in
`2002. In April 2008, Navi2Go - a Mobile Navigation Solution, was launched across the U.S. and
`UK. Within two months, Navi2Go became Most Popular and Best Seller on Sprint, Verizon, Alltel
`and Orange UKsoftware shops.

`President & CEO
`
`Arche Tevhnologies
`1987 — 1990 (3 years)
`
`Arche Technologies was a maker of IBM PC compatibles that competed mainly on performance.
`Its systemstypically rated in the top-tier in head-to-head tests. The first US PC manufacturer to
`offer two years warranty.
`
`VP
`
`Leading Edge USA
`1985 — 1987 (2 years)
`
`Leading Edge Hardware makerof the Mode! D the "the King of the Clone"
`(http://en.wikipedia.org/wiki/Leading_Edge_Model_D)
`The Model D was an immediate success,selling 100,000 unitsinits first year of production.

`Efficient image parcel texture rendering with T-junction crack elimination >
`United States 6,850,235
`Issued February 2005
`
`Defects are removed from a tessellated polygonal mesh provided for the rendering of polygon
`corresponding image parcels through a processthat first determines, for a predetermined segment
`of a first edge of a first polygon within the polygonal mesh,a difference in tessellation level
`between the first polygon and a second polygon disposed adjacent the predetermined edge of the
`first polygon, subject to the occurrenceof a defect in the polygonal mesh betweenthe first and
`second polygons. A terminusof the predetermined segmentis then computed based on the
`difference in the tessellation levels and a new vertex, corresponding to the terminus, is added to a
`first set of vertices that define the first polygon. An image parcel can then be rendered based on
`the set of vertices, including the added vertex, suchthatthe first image parcel as rendered covers
`the defect in the polygonal mesh between the first and second polygons.
`Inventors: Isaac Levanon

`System and methodsfor network image delivery with dynamic viewing
`frustum optimized for limited bandwidth communication channels »
`United States 7,139,794
`Issued November 2006
`
`Dynamic visualization of image data provided through a network communications channel is
`performed by a client system including a parcel request subsystem and a parcel rendering
`subsystem. The parcel request subsystem includes a parcel request queue and is operative to
`request discrete image data parcels in a priority order and to store received image data parcels in a
`parcel data store. The parcel request subsystem is responsive to an image parcel request of
`assigned prionty to place the image parcel requestin the parcel request queue ordered in
`correspondencewith the assigned priority. The parcel rendering subsystem is coupled to the parcel
`data store to selectively retrieve and render received image data parcels to a display memory. The
`parcel rendering system provides the parcel request subsystem with the image parcel request of
`the assigned pronty.
`Inventors: Isaac Levanon
`
`Adaptive quadtree-based scalable surface rendering »
`United States 7,561,156
`Issued July 2009
`
`A 3D scalable surface rendererallows efficient real-time 3D rendering of high-detail smooth
`surfaces. The renderer is exceptionally effective with software rendering and low-end weaker
`graphics accelerators, and provides excellent visible quality per the amount of polygons used, while
`retaining low CPU processing overhead and highefficiency on graphics hardware. The 3D scalable
`surface renderer provides real time rendering of extremely detailed smooth surfaces with view-
`dependenttessellation using an improved level of detail approach.
`Inventors: Isaac Levanon

`Optimized image delivery over limited bandwidth communication channels »
`United States 7,908,343
`Issued March 2011
`
`Large-scale images are retrieved over network communications channels for display on a client
`device by selecting an update imageparcel relative to an operator controlled image viewpoint to
`display via the client device. A requestis prepared for the update image parcel and associated with
`a request queue for subsequent issuance over a communications channel. The update image
`parcel is received from the communications channel and displayed as a discrete portion of the
`predetermined image. The update image parcel optimally has a fixed pixelarray size, is received in
`a single and orplurality of network data packets, and is constrained to a resolution less than or
`equal to the resolution of the client device display.
`Inventors: Isaac Levanon
